// Copyright (c) 2024-2026 Antony Polukhin
//
// Distributed under the Boost Software License, Version 1.0. (See accompanying
// file LICENSE_1_0.txt or copy at http://www.boost.org/LICENSE_1_0.txt)
#include <boost/pfr/tuple_size.hpp>
#include <climits>
#include <cstdint>
#if defined(__clang__)
# define ARRAY_MAX INT_MAX
# define OBJECT_MAX SIZE_MAX
#elif defined(__GNUC__)
# define ARRAY_MAX INT_MAX
# define OBJECT_MAX (SIZE_MAX >> 1)
#elif defined(_MSC_VER)
# define ARRAY_MAX INT_MAX
# define OBJECT_MAX UINT_MAX
#else // Let's play it safe
# define ARRAY_MAX INT_MAX
# define OBJECT_MAX INT_MAX
#endif
#pragma pack(1)
struct A {
char x[ARRAY_MAX <= (OBJECT_MAX >> 3) ? ARRAY_MAX : OBJECT_MAX >> 3];
};
struct B {
A a;
A b;
A c;
A d;
A e;
A f;
A g;
A h;
};
struct C {
A& a;
A b;
A c;
A d;
A e;
A f;
A g;
A h;
};
#pragma pack()
int main() {
#ifndef _MSC_VER
static_assert(boost::pfr::tuple_size_v<char[ARRAY_MAX]> == ARRAY_MAX, "");
#endif
static_assert(boost::pfr::tuple_size_v<B> == 8, "");
static_assert(boost::pfr::tuple_size_v<C> == 8, "");
}
